On April 19, 1987, The Simpsons made their TV debut as animated shorts during the FOX television series The Tracey Ullman Show… and pop culture would never be the same! Just a few years later, in 1990, The Simpsons would become its own FOX animated series; now the longest-running primetime scripted TV series in history (animated or not), it continues to delight viewers all over the world. Check Out The Simpsons’ Milestone 800th Episode on Hulu and Hulu on Disney+
In the episode titled “Irrational Treasure,” which originally aired on FOX this past February 15, Marge (Julie Kavner) enters Santa’s Little Helper into the National Dog Show in Philadelphia—and adventure ensues! Guest voices on the episode included Kevin Bacon, and Abbott Elementary’s Quinta Brunson.

Other milestone and fan-favorite episodes are also available to stream—including, among many others, the 200th episode from 1998, entitled “Trash of the Titans”; the 400th episode from 2007, entitled “You Kent Always Say What You Want”; and the 666th episode, which was (naturally) 2019’s Treehouse of Horror XXX.
